tags 897732 patch
thanks
Hi,
Attached is a series of patches to make this package build with gcc-8:
1. Fix invalid gbp.conf so `gbp buildpackage` can actually run.
2. Update the symbols file to remove the symbol that no longer exists in
gcc-8.
3. Update changelog for NMU.
I can't upload this myself, so feel free to take any parts of these
patches to make the package build again, or just upload my series of
patches as is.
Thanks!
-- Kunal
From 943ce8a954f2ba959cbadeda0fc9dc9b0a0fefcc Mon Sep 17 00:00:00 2001
From: Kunal Mehta
Date: Sat, 21 Jul 2018 01:54:06 +0200
Subject: [PATCH 1/3] Fix invalid gbp.conf
---
debian/gbp.conf | 3 +--
1 file changed, 1 insertion(+), 2 deletions(-)
diff --git a/debian/gbp.conf b/debian/gbp.conf
index fc366af..1ef1248 100644
--- a/debian/gbp.conf
+++ b/debian/gbp.conf
@@ -1,7 +1,6 @@
# Configuration file for git-buildpackage and friends
[git-import-orig]
-filter = .gitignore
-filter = debian/
+filter = [ '.gitignore', 'debian/' ]
[DEFAULT]
pristine-tar = True
--
2.17.1
From 0f16dff1fea9c9e144946a6b4fb663a38d25a2c3 Mon Sep 17 00:00:00 2001
From: Kunal Mehta
Date: Sat, 21 Jul 2018 01:59:29 +0200
Subject: [PATCH 2/3] Update symbols for gcc-8
Closes: #897732
---
debian/libctpp2-2v5.symbols | 1 -
1 file changed, 1 deletion(-)
diff --git a/debian/libctpp2-2v5.symbols b/debian/libctpp2-2v5.symbols
index 9507b84..b6e8190 100644
--- a/debian/libctpp2-2v5.symbols
+++ b/debian/libctpp2-2v5.symbols
@@ -1305,7 +1305,6 @@ libctpp2.so.2 libctpp2-2v5 #MINVER#
(optional=templinst|arch=alpha amd64 arm64 armel armhf hppa hurd-i386 i386 kfreebsd-amd64 kfreebsd-i386 m68k mips mips64el mipsel powerpc powerpcspe ppc64 ppc64el s390x sh4 sparc64)_ZNSt8_Rb_treeINS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EESt4pairIKS5_N4CTPP3CDTEESt10_Select1stISA_ESt4lessIS5_ESaISA_EE7_M_copyINSG_11_Alloc_nodeEEEPSt13_Rb_tree_nodeISA_EPKSK_PSt18_Rb_tree_node_baseRT_@Base 2.8.3
(arch=!alpha !amd64 !arm64 !armel !armhf !hppa !hurd-i386 !i386 !kfreebsd-amd64 !kfreebsd-i386 !m68k !mips !mips64el !mipsel !powerpc !powerpcspe !ppc64 !ppc64el !s390x !sh4 !sparc64)_ZNSt8_Rb_treeINS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EESt4pairIKS5_N4CTPP3CDTEESt10_Select1stISA_ESt4lessIS5_ESaISA_EE7_M_copyINSG_11_Alloc_nodeEEEPSt13_Rb_tree_nodeISA_EPKSK_SL_RT_@Base 2.8.3
_ZNSt8_Rb_treeINS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EESt4pairIKS5_N4CTPP3CDTEESt10_Select1stISA_ESt4lessIS5_ESaISA_EE8_M_eraseEPSt13_Rb_tree_nodeISA_E@Base 2.8.3
- (arch=!armel !armhf !hurd-i386 !i386 !kfreebsd-i386 !mips !mipsel !powerpc)_ZNSt8_Rb_treeINS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EESt4pairIKS5_PvESt10_Select1stIS9_ESt4lessIS5_ESaIS9_EE24_M_get_insert_unique_posERS7_@Base 2.8.3
_ZNSt8_Rb_treeINS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EESt4pairIKS5_PvESt10_Select1stIS9_ESt4lessIS5_ESaIS9_EE8_M_eraseEPSt13_Rb_tree_nodeIS9_E@Base 2.8.3
(arch=!alpha !amd64 !arm64 !armel !armhf !hppa !hurd-i386 !i386 !kfreebsd-amd64 !kfreebsd-i386 !m68k !mips !mips64el !mipsel !powerpc !powerpcspe !ppc64 !ppc64el !s390x !sh4 !sparc64)_ZNSt8_Rb_treeINS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EESt4pairIKS5_S5_ESt10_Select1stIS8_ESt4lessIS5_ESaIS8_EE7_M_copyINSE_11_Alloc_nodeEEEPSt13_Rb_tree_nodeIS8_EPKSI_SJ_RT_@Base 2.8.3
_ZNSt8_Rb_treeINS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EESt4pairIKS5_S5_ESt10_Select1stIS8_ESt4lessIS5_ESaIS8_EE8_M_eraseEPSt13_Rb_tree_nodeIS8_E@Base 2.8.3
--
2.17.1
From 94a19cf551abd836561faeb54b85b9dd68d88d28 Mon Sep 17 00:00:00 2001
From: Kunal Mehta
Date: Sat, 21 Jul 2018 02:08:04 +0200
Subject: [PATCH 3/3] Update changelog
---
debian/changelog | 8
1 file changed, 8 insertions(+)
diff --git a/debian/changelog b/debian/changelog
index 5b03301..5e9589e 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-1,3 +1,11 @@
+ctpp2 (2.8.3-23.1) unstable; urgency=medium
+
+ * Non-maintainer upload.
+ * Fix invalid gbp.conf
+ * Update symbols for gcc-8 (Closes: #897732)
+
+ -- Kunal Mehta Sat, 21 Jul 2018 02:07:32 +0200
+
ctpp2 (2.8.3-23) unstable; urgency=medium
* Update symbols file for all architectures.
--
2.17.1
signature.asc
Description: OpenPGP digital signature